About Corsican Language

According to Wikipedia.org, The Corsican language is spoken by about 341,000 people in the world. The native speakers live in Corsica while some others live in Paris, Marseilles, Bolivia, Canada, and Cuba. However, it is surprising that this language doesn’t have any status in Corsica. French is the official language of Corsica. There isn’t any daily and weekly newspaper available in the Corsican language. Only a few French-language papers make use of this language to publish articles at times. Corsican is used for the official headlines only. Some political and cultural associations make sure that something in the Corsican language is printed in the magazines. The regional TV and radio station makes use of the Corsican language in several bulletins. Apart from that this language is used at all levels of education.

About Irish Language

According to Wikipedia.org, Irish is the official language of Ireland but there are Irish speakers in UK, USA, and Canada too. According to the census in 2016, around 1.76 million people speak Irish. There are around three main dialects of the Irish language. It involves Munster (An Mhumhain), Connacht (Connachta) and Ulster (Ulaidh). This language is written in Ogham alphabets while it also features Gaelic script. If we talk about the modern Irish it is written with a combination of Latin words. The spellings don’t reflect the pronunciation of various alphabets. For example ‘bia’ is known as food in English. This can change in some other dialects especially in the Munster pronunciation. There are a lot of irregularities seen in both spellings and pronunciations.
